The Evolution of Digital Fishing Games
Traditionally, fishing games in the digital realm were primarily designed for dedicated enthusiasts, often requiring significant investment in hardware or console accessories. Early titles like Big Fish’s Fishmaster or Rapala’s series captured the pastime’s serenity but were primarily paid or subscription-based. However, the paradigm started shifting around the late 2000s with the proliferation of smartphones, which democratised gaming, making casual, low-threshold games more prevalent.
Today, a predominant trend is the rise of free-to-play (F2P) models within this genre, allowing users to enjoy immersive fishing experiences without upfront cost, monetising through optional microtransactions, advertisements, and premium upgrades. This shift is symptomatic of broader industry dynamics, where user acquisition and retention hinge on offering compelling free content, then monetising engaged players.

Design and Monetisation Strategies in Modern Fishing Games
Contemporary free-to-play fishing games are distinguished by:
- Accessible gameplay mechanics: Simple controls suitable for players of all ages.
- Progression systems: Unlocking new rods, bait, or fishing spots as players advance.
- Social features: Sharing catches, competing in leaderboards, or co-op fishing expeditions.
The monetisation approach prioritises seamless integration; microtransactions are designed as optional enhancements rather than pay-to-win features. This aligns with industry best practices to maintain Fair Play and Player Satisfaction, confirmed by recent research in user retention rates.
